About Jan Špáta

Jan Spáta was born on October 25, 1932 in Náchod, Czechoslovakia [now Czech Republic]. He was a cinematographer and director, known for Nejvetsí prání II (1990), Mezi svetlem a tmou (1990) and A kdo je vinen? (1971). He was married to Olga Sommerová. He died on August 18, 2006 in Prague, Czech Republic.
